Conductivity measurement

If water evaporates in the cooling tower water cycle then the concentration of remaining salts rises constantly. This increased salinity can be monitored with a measuring device for electrolytic conductivity to be able to prevent this process. In conjunction with the JUMO ecoLine Ci inductive conductivity and temperature sensor the JUMO AQUIS 500 Ci transmitter and controller is perfect for desalination control thanks to its switching contacts.

Evaporative cooling towers bring with them the risk of water "thickening". When the water evaporates, the dissolved salt is precipitated. Due to the increased ion concentration this effect can be measured and caught appropriately through the conductivity of the water. We can offer you measurement and control technology with complete process reliability for this task in the form of the JUMO ecoLine Ci conductivity electrode and the JUMO AQUIS 500 Ci.
